Duties
At Egger Truck, we offer service for heavy trucks and trailers. The truck technician repairs and maintains diesel and gasoline engines. This person has a good mechanical understanding of electrical, driveline and hydraulic systems and works both on-site and off-site on service calls for emergency breakdowns. The truck technician maintains a respectful demeanor while working with the team and with our customers.
- Ability to repair and diagnose gasoline and diesel trucks and trailers including but not limited to; hydraulics, brakes, engines, driveline, transmissions, steering and suspension with the ability to replace other parts as needed.
- Perform scheduled maintenance, preventative maintenance and DOT inspections.
- Maintain shop equipment in good operating order
- Maintain service truck and report to your manager any deficiencies
- Maintain and keep work area clean and safe
- Able to work full time with overtime in the busy season.
- Attend training as required by management to maintain proficiency in his/her job description
- Adhere to the Health & Safety program, policies and procedures
- Be present for monthly safety meetings
- Sundry duties as needed
